Jetted tubs differ from standard bathtubs primarily in their design and functionality. While a typical bathtub offers a simple soaking experience, jetted tubs feature built-in jets that release streams of water, providing a therapeutic massage effect. This added feature enhances relaxation and can be particularly beneficial for soothing sore muscles or simply enjoying a more luxurious bathing experience. Many guests find that the hydrotherapy benefits of jetted tubs help in alleviating stress and promoting circulation, making them a popular choice for vacationers seeking comfort.
Yes, there are several health considerations to be mindful of when using a jetted tub. While soaking can be relaxing, it's important to ensure the water temperature is safe and comfortable, generally around 100-102°F (37-39°C) is recommended. Individuals with certain health conditions, such as cardiovascular issues, should consult a doctor before using a jetted tub. Additionally, maintaining good hygiene is vital; ensure the tub is well-cleaned before use, as bacteria can thrive in warm, damp environments. Lastly, be aware of your hydration levels, as prolonged soaking can lead to dehydration.
